Abstract |
This thesis describes the design and evaluation of ThroughView, an in-vehicle visual assistance system, that allows the driver to "see through" the backseat and observe the rear blind zone. Devices for indirect vision such as rearview mirrors do not o er a complete rearward view. Camera systems show a wide view but on a small display and tend to be panoramically distorted. An augmented vision system, known as the transparent cockpit, uses retrore ective projection technology to let drivers virtually see through the car interior, but has not been designed as an aid for driving. Based on the transparent cockpit, the proposed system in this thesis combines the directly-observed view with a camera image of the rear blind zone, thereby expands the rearward view that drivers see when they physically look back. The nal design is a compact, attachable device that can be secured onto the back of the driver seat. Evaluation of the system involving reverse driving tasks shows ThroughView to be e ective as a visual aid in backing maneuvres and is intuitive to use.
